Sha256: 0683fea244e6e630d235eaf7ce91a4e9c03d024f6bd89aa0fdeb902e0e77f1e9

Contents?: true

Size: 403 Bytes

Versions: 28

Compression:

Stored size: 403 Bytes

Contents

module GraphQL
  module Models
    module ScalarTypes
      def self.registered_type(database_type)
        @registered_types ||= {}.with_indifferent_access
        @registered_types[database_type]
      end

      def self.register(database_type, graphql_type)
        @registered_types ||= {}.with_indifferent_access
        @registered_types[database_type] = graphql_type
      end
    end
  end
end

Version data entries

28 entries across 28 versions & 1 rubygems

Version Path
graphql-activerecord-0.9.1 lib/graphql/models/scalar_types.rb
graphql-activerecord-0.9.0 lib/graphql/models/scalar_types.rb
graphql-activerecord-0.8.0 lib/graphql/models/scalar_types.rb
graphql-activerecord-0.7.3 lib/graphql/models/scalar_types.rb
graphql-activerecord-0.7.2 lib/graphql/models/scalar_types.rb
graphql-activerecord-0.8.0.pre.alpha1 lib/graphql/models/scalar_types.rb
graphql-activerecord-0.7.1 lib/graphql/models/scalar_types.rb
graphql-activerecord-0.7.0 lib/graphql/models/scalar_types.rb
graphql-activerecord-0.6.7 lib/graphql/models/scalar_types.rb
graphql-activerecord-0.6.6 lib/graphql/models/scalar_types.rb
graphql-activerecord-0.6.5 lib/graphql/models/scalar_types.rb
graphql-activerecord-0.6.4 lib/graphql/models/scalar_types.rb
graphql-activerecord-0.6.3 lib/graphql/models/scalar_types.rb
graphql-activerecord-0.6.2 lib/graphql/models/scalar_types.rb
graphql-activerecord-0.6.1 lib/graphql/models/scalar_types.rb
graphql-activerecord-0.6.0 lib/graphql/models/scalar_types.rb
graphql-activerecord-0.5.6 lib/graphql/models/scalar_types.rb
graphql-activerecord-0.5.5 lib/graphql/models/scalar_types.rb
graphql-activerecord-0.5.4 lib/graphql/models/scalar_types.rb
graphql-activerecord-0.5.3 lib/graphql/models/scalar_types.rb